A case of inflammatory fibroid polyp (IFP) developed in the ileum is reported.<br>A 56-year-old woman was admitted to the hospital because of several episodes of recurrent crampy abdominal pain after meals. Plain films of the abdomen revealed dilated loops of the small bowel with air-fluid levels. Mechanical small bowel obstrcution and an intraluminal mass were suspected on CT films. On exploratory laparotomy an intussusception of the small bowel was found. Enterectomy about 70 cm was performed. Histologically, the tumor, 3.2×2.8×2.8 cm in size, occupied the submucosa, and there was an ulceration on the top of the tumor. The inflammatory cell infiltration was composed predominantly of eosinophils and lymphocytes. The fibroblasts had disintegrated in the lumina muscularis mucosa. As a result, CT will become valuable to make a diagnosis of intraluminal tumor. The diagnosis and proper enterectomy for submucosal tumors in the small intestine, especially IFP, are discussed based on our experience as well as a review of the literature.
